Online Dating: Holiday Tips for Singles


The holiday season can be a challenging time for singles, often marketed as a time for families and couples. If you're single, you might feel like an outsider amidst the festivities. Here are some tips to help you not only survive but thrive during this time of year.

Embrace the Holiday Season


Instead of feeling down about spending another holiday season alone, consider the following approaches:

- Plan Your Holidays: Decide where you want to spend the holidays and find ways to keep loneliness at bay.
- Stay Positive: Even if it feels unfair to celebrate another Christmas without a partner, focusing on the positives can help.
- Handle Nosy Relatives with Grace: Be prepared with a light-hearted or thoughtful response for when family members ask, "Why are you still single?"

Staying Cheerful


Winter doesn't have to bring you down. Here are a few ways to stay cheerful:

- Celebrate New Year’s Eve at Home: If you're spending it alone, embrace the opportunity for self-care.
- Order your favorite pizza, settle in with some great movies, and enjoy your own company.
- Connect with friends across the country for a long phone catch-up.
- Host a small dinner for other single friends, creating your own festive atmosphere.

Discover Online Dating


If none of these activities appeal to you, there's always online dating?"a convenient way to meet new people:

- Variety of Choices: Online dating platforms offer a wide range of potential partners, expanding your dating pool beyond friends and family.
- Get to Know Before Meeting: Learn more about potential dates through profiles and chats before meeting in person.
- Enhanced Security: By corresponding online first, you can better identify trustworthy individuals.

The Perks of Going Solo


While it can feel a bit lonely to attend holiday parties alone, many singles choose to embrace it:

- According to a Yahoo Personals Survey, 86% of singles are willing to go solo to holiday events, although 43% find it a bit sad. Remember, you’re not alone in feeling this way.

Look Forward to New Beginnings


Feelings of being single and longing for a partner are normal, but there’s always hope just around the corner. With many opportunities online, the chance to connect with someone special is just a few clicks away.

By following these tips, you can embrace the holiday season with a positive attitude and maybe even set yourself up for an exciting new romance in the new year.
